Transaction 80637ebe3401e869c3da86459f517473b40d8641ef0c2ca8ddc56848f7ea14de
1 Input
1 Output
-
80637ebe3401e869c3da86459f517473b40d8641ef0c2ca8ddc56848f7ea14de:0
- value
- 850388
- script pubkey
- OP_0 OP_PUSHBYTES_20 8495f832515a8847c39253387df1d93a24b7ee32
- address
- bc1qsj2lsvj3t2yy0suj2vu8muwe8gjt0m3jxhkhk3